Questioner: But the path to liberation is not to be found where there are sectarian divisions( gachha), is it?
Dadashri: Yes, when there is a sect; that is the end of it. But people create such divisions:‘ this is mine, mine is different and their’ s is different’.
Questioner: Then he is bound to fall.
Dadashri: He has already fallen. He falls from the moment he moves away.
Speech without ownership is the sign of the Gnani
Entire‘ I-ness’( potapanu) gradually melts down to zero after attaining Gnan. One is considered a Gnani when it goes down to zero. Then his speech( vani) will change. Vani flows only after potapanu leaves. By whatever proportion the‘ I-ness’ goes away, that much speech will arise, and that speech is correct. Until then all speech is wrong. Elsewhere, except for those who have taken our Gnan, there is a presence of‘ I-ness’ whenever people speak. Such speech will not have any effect; it will blow away in the wind. That is not speech; it is all relative. As for our mahatmas, they are to speak only after their‘ I-ness’ is gone, otherwise they are not to speak.
Moreover can any mahatma who has taken Gnan speak even a single sentence that is his own and stand independently? No. This is the sign that no one has attained the‘ main’ thing yet. No one has attained the absolute state yet. He cannot speak even a single sentence; if he did, I would be astonished. I would say,‘ that is enough proof!’ I would realize that it is amazing if I were to hear even a single sentence! But it is not possible, is it? How can he utter even a single sentence? How can vani( speech) flow? How can the speech without ownership flow?
